Having recently completed a 914/6 conversion, I would like to add a proper emblem to the rear valence. The one I am looking for is the gold one which spells out "914-6 VW Porsche". Porsche has discontinued this emblem. Does anyone know where I can source one for our car?

You might try Auto Atlanta (they list one on their website for $175) or perhaps Mittelmotor. They'd be pretty rare in the states, though the 914-6 emblem has been reproduced.
